One of the primary draws of the Florida Keys is its remarkable marine life. The waters surrounding the islands are alive with color and diversity, boasting one of the largest coral reef systems in the United States. Divers and snorkelers flock to renowned spots like John Pennekamp Coral Reef State Park, where they can immerse themselves in a breathtaking underwater world teeming with kaleidoscopic fish, graceful sea turtles, and playful dolphins. This underwater wonderland offers not just recreation but also an opportunity to understand and appreciate the delicate ecosystems that thrive beneath the waves.
A visit to the Keys also promises cultural enrichment, with each island offering its unique charm and attractions. Key West, the southernmost point of the continental United States, is a veritable cornucopia of artistic expression and historical significance. The island exudes a bohemian spirit, reflected in its vibrant arts scene and numerous galleries. The hauntingly beautiful sunsets at Mallory Square present a daily carnival-like atmosphere, where performers, artists, and locals gather to celebrate the day’s end.

In addition to its artistic allure, the Keys are steeped in history. Historic landmarks, such as the Ernest Hemingway Home and Museum, embody the essence of the region’s literary heritage, inviting guests to walk in the footsteps of one of America’s most celebrated authors. Exploring the rich historical context of the islands adds depth to the overall travel experience, allowing visitors to forge a connection with the destination that transcends mere leisure.
For those seeking more than just sun and sand, the Florida Keys offer exceptional culinary adventures as well. With a cornucopia of fresh seafood delicacies available, food enthusiasts can indulge in local specialties such as conch fritters, stone crab, and key lime pie. The vibrant gastronomic scene showcases both casual beachside shacks and upscale dining establishments, each offering a delectable taste of the ocean and a sense of the Keys’ storied traditions.
